Web11 jan. 2024 · In 2024, landings of brown shrimp totaled 71 million pounds and were valued at $164 million, according to the NOAA Fisheries commercial fishing landings database. The three species of penaeid shrimp ( white, pink, and brown) make up the vast majority of the shrimp harvested in the southeast. Web12 nov. 2024 · How does shrimp swim? Unlike fish, shrimp do not have fins that enable them to swim, but they can certainly move around in the water. A shrimp “swims” by quickly pulling its abdomen in toward its carapace (body). This motion shoots them through the water.
